The U.S. Coast Guard introduced Thursday that it had detected a Russian army spy ship working close to U.S. territorial waters on Oct. 29, and personnel proceed to watch the ship.
Officers mentioned the Vishnya-class intelligence ship was about 15 nautical miles south of Oahu, prompting a response from the Coast Guard HC-130 Hercules from Air Station Barbers Level and the Coast Guard cutter William Hart.
The Coast Guard responded to the ship of the Basic Intelligence Service of the Russian Federation, Kareliya, by conducting a protected {and professional} flight and crusing near the ship, a information launch mentioned.

Appearing in accordance with worldwide legislation, the Coast Guard mentioned personnel are monitoring the ship’s actions close to U.S. territorial waters to offer maritime safety for U.S. vessels working within the space.
Coast Guardsmen may also monitor the ship in help of U.S. protection efforts.
“The U.S. Coast Guard routinely screens maritime actions across the Hawaiian Islands and within the Pacific Ocean to make sure the protection of U.S. waters,” Capt. Matthew Chong, chief of response for the Coast Guard Oceania District, wrote in an announcement.

Based on the US Military web site, the Vishnya class is a gaggle of intelligence assortment ships constructed for the Soviet Navy within the Nineteen Eighties. There are nonetheless seven ships in service with the Russian Navy.
They’re massive, purpose-built vessels designed to gather alerts via an in depth array of sensors, the location mentioned. Knowledge will be transmitted to shore by way of satellite tv for pc hyperlink antennas.
Though the ships are designed for intelligence gathering, they’re armed with two AK-630 close-in weapon techniques and SA-N-8 surface-to-air missile launchers (SAM), for self-defense of final resort, in accordance with the army.

Coast Guard Oceania District works with the U.S. Indo-Pacific Command and inter-agency companions to constantly monitor the exercise of overseas army vessels working close to U.S. territorial waters to make sure homeland safety and protection.
Underneath customary worldwide legislation, overseas army ships are allowed to sail and function exterior the territorial waters of different international locations, which lengthen as much as 12 nautical miles from the coast.
